我正在尝试编辑我的.gitconfig以添加一个快捷方式,该快捷方式考虑到我当前的分支并推送它,即使尚未定义上游。 要引用我当前的分支,我通常会这样做:
git symbolic-ref --short HEAD
我的问题是此解决方案不能用于快捷方式。
我想要做的是推送当前分支并设置其上游分支。目前我这样做:
git push -u origin <my-current-branch>
我想创建一个快捷方式:
git pu
如何在我的.gitconfig中添加对当前分支的引用?
注意:可以是我正在工作的任何分支
答案 0 :(得分:2)
这就是你所需要的:
git config --global alias.pu 'push -u origin HEAD'